Описание:

Organoids are complex three-dimensional in vitro organ-like model systems. Organoids can be derived from pluripotent stem cells or primary donor tissue and have been used to address fundamental questions about development, stem cell biology and organ regeneration. Human organoids have invigorated new exploration into the cellular makeup of human organs during development, in the adult and during disease. Efforts to improve complexity in organoid systems, and to make organoid systems more robust, reproducible and controlled have prompted continued refinement of methods used to generate and culture organoids. This volume will highlight recent and emerging advances that describe organoid differentiation protocols for many different organ systems, that implement organoids as tools to understand complexity and maturation, high content drug screening, disease modeling, and understanding development and evolution. Readers can expect to gain knowledge in the most recent differentiation protocols from experts in their respective areas.

Описание: Human pluripotent stem cells such as human embryonic stem cells (hESC) and induced pluripotent stem cells (iPSC) with their unique developmental plasticity hold immense potential as cellular models for drug discovery and in regenerative medicine as a source for cell replacement. While hESC are derived from a developing embryo, iPSC are generated with forced expression of key transcription factors to convert adult somatic cells to ESC-like cells, a process termed reprogramming. Using iPSC overcomes ethical issues concerning the use of developing embryos and it can be generated from patient-specific or disease-specific cells for downstream applications.
